‘The Odyssey’s’ Bad Rap Gets Worse With a Cringe Cast Video That’s Giving Listeners an Epic Earache

Photo by Scott A Garfitt/Invision/AP

Director Christopher Nolan’s film The Odyssey has been plagued with controversy almost since he announced the enormous project. Many were upset with his casting choices and his decision to have characters speak in modern English. A rap song was even recorded that plays over the closing credits. Yes, really. Posters say Homer’s epic poem deserves better. Keeping with that bizarre musical choice, another 'rap' song was recorded by the cast and filmed to promote the movie. It dropped on Thursday.
